[Page] 25Country Part of Bute
Wheel Carriage Tax
from 5th April 1788 to 5th April 1789 By Robert Aitken Surveyor
I Robert Aiken Surveyor aforesaid Do hereby
Certify that upon careful examination of the foregoing Rates
and Duties I find they Amount in whole to Three pounds
ten Shillings Sterling and that upon the Fifteenth day of
December Current I delivered to Mr Alexander May Collector
of said Rates for the County of Bute an Exact duplicate of the duty
examined & compared with the foregoing Account to which I have
added my oath thatnotifications were delivered or left
of the dates foresaid and that the Rates Charged on said Acct [Account]
were just & true to the best of my Skill & knowledge and to
the best of my belief no person liable to be Charged was
omitted
Robert Aitken
